Oranges of 2.5-in-diameter (k = 0.26 Btu/h·ft·°F and α = 1.4 × 10−6 ft2/s) initially at a uniform temperature of 78°F are to be cooled by refrigerated air at 25°F flowing at a velocity of 1 ft/s. The average heat transfer coefficient between the oranges and the air is experimentally determined to be 4.6 Btu/h·ft2·°F. Determine how long it will take for the center temperature of the oranges to drop to 40°F. Also, determine if any part of the oranges will freeze during this process.
